Looks like there will only be a few more 2-day GTD seminars

I just received the latest edition of David Allen's Productivity Principles newsletter and read this eye-opening notice:

I’ll be doing only four more two-day open Getting Things Done seminars this year – Boston, Washington DC, London, and Miami – and those will likely be the last public “Managing Workflow, Projects and Priorities” seminars I will be doing in the foreseeable future. We are developing a new one-day format for public seminars that will be launching in the spring of 2005, along with new programs designed for people who are seriously committed to getting themselves and their teams to “black belt.” So, for those of you who haven’t yet done the live two-day event, or those of you who know you need to kick it up a notch again, make plans now before these sell out, and the live GTD’s are no more.

If you've had attending a GTD seminar on your Someday/Maybe list, it's time to make it a Next Action!
